Änderung der URL in der Welcome Mail

phpBB 3.0 hat sein "End of Life" erreicht. Eine Neu-Installation wird nicht mehr unterstützt.
Gesperrt
Reinhard_cologne
Mitglied
Beiträge: 11
Registriert: 14.03.2005 09:57

Änderung der URL in der Welcome Mail

Beitrag von Reinhard_cologne »

Hallo,
nach Umstieg auf phpBB3 stelle ich fest, dass in der User Welcome Mail der Link auf das Forum Verzeichnis angegeben wird, also z.B. http://meineseite.de/phpbb3/ .In meinem Fall möchte ich aber, dass nur http://meineseite.de angegeben wird, weil ich diese Seite auf das Forum umleite. Der Platzhalter für die URL findet sicht in der Datei user_welcome.txt und heisst {U_BOARD}. Der Platzhalter müsste aus Domain-Name und Scriptpfad gebildet worden sein. Ich könnte natürlich die URL fest in der Mail eintragen.... lieber würde ich das aber professionell lösen.
Jeder Tip ist willkommen.
Gruss
Reinhard
Benutzeravatar
sepp71
Mitglied
Beiträge: 919
Registriert: 23.12.2006 00:03

Re: Änderung der URL in der Welcome Mail

Beitrag von sepp71 »

Hm, das Problem müßte ich dann eigentlich auch haben - habe ich aber nicht.
Hast Du mal im ACP / Server und Domain nachgeschaut, was dort
a.) als Domain-Name (soll: deineurl.de) und
b.) als Skript-Pfad (soll: /phpbb3)
steht?
Bei mir wird das jedenfalls dann korrekt verschickt.
Gruß
Sepp

Achtung: Alle Angaben ohne Gewähr!
Reinhard_cologne
Mitglied
Beiträge: 11
Registriert: 14.03.2005 09:57

Re: Änderung der URL in der Welcome Mail

Beitrag von Reinhard_cologne »

Hallo Sepp,
genau so

Code: Alles auswählen

a.) als Domain-Name (deineurl.de) und
b.) als Skript-Pfad ( /phpbb3)
ist es bei mir eingetragen
Reinhard_cologne
Mitglied
Beiträge: 11
Registriert: 14.03.2005 09:57

Re: Änderung der URL in der Welcome Mail

Beitrag von Reinhard_cologne »

Hallo,
ich habe nochmal geforscht...
In /includes/functions.php findet sich diese Funktionsdefinition

Code: Alles auswählen

/**
* Generate board url (example: http://www.example.com/phpBB)
* @param bool $without_script_path if set to true the script path gets not appended (example: http://www.example.com)
*/
function generate_board_url($without_script_path = false)
Ich habe ($without_script_path = true) gesetzt und dann geht's.
Warum diese Einstellung hier im Code fest verankert ist und nicht administriert werden kann, versteh ich nicht.
Reinhard_cologne
Mitglied
Beiträge: 11
Registriert: 14.03.2005 09:57

Re: Änderung der URL in der Welcome Mail

Beitrag von Reinhard_cologne »

zu früh gefreut - jetzt wird die Welcome Mail zwar mit der korrekten URL bestückt, aber der Redirect nach der Anmeldung funktioniert nicht mehr, weil der URL dann noch index.php angehängt wird. Und die url http://meineseite.de/index.php existiert nicht.
Bin also wieder offen für Vorschläge.
Benutzeravatar
nickvergessen
Ehrenadmin
Beiträge: 11559
Registriert: 09.10.2006 21:56
Wohnort: Stuttgart, Germany
Kontaktdaten:

Re: Änderung der URL in der Welcome Mail

Beitrag von nickvergessen »

Mach das mal wieder rückgängig,
anschließend öffne includes/functions_messenger.php
finde:

Code: Alles auswählen

'U_BOARD'	=> generate_board_url(),
ersetze mit:

Code: Alles auswählen

'U_BOARD'	=> generate_board_url(true),
kein Support per PN
Reinhard_cologne
Mitglied
Beiträge: 11
Registriert: 14.03.2005 09:57

Re: Änderung der URL in der Welcome Mail

Beitrag von Reinhard_cologne »

Hallo nickvergessen
super, vielen Dank, genau das war die Lösung
Gruss
Reinhard
Gesperrt

Zurück zu „[3.0.x] Installation, Update und Konvertierung“